Create a New Contact:

  1. Launch “Contacts”
  2. Go to “All contacts”
  3. Tap “+” and select an account type and the account you want to use for contact syncing. Alternatively you can choose a different storing method
  4. Tap “Done”

Import/Export Contacts:

  1. Open “Contacts”
  2. Tap “Menu” > “Import/Export”
  3. Select to “Import from storage”, “Import from SIM” or “Export to storage”
  4. Follow the on-screen steps to complete the process

Add Contacts to Speed Dial:

  1. Tap and hold an empty area on the home screen
  2. Access “Widgets”
  3. Drag the “Direct Dial” widget and drop it over an empty area on the home screen
  4. When prompted, select the contact you want to link with the widget

NOTE: You can repeat the steps above to add multiple Direct Dial widgets for additional contacts on the home screen. You can also organize these widgets in folders on the home screen by dragging one and dropping it over another.

Reset the Call Log:

  1. Open “Phone”
  2. Tap “Menu” and access “Call history”
  3. To view more details on a call log entry, select it
  4. To reset the call log, tap “Menu” > “Call history”
  5. Tap “Clear call log”

Remove a Contact:

  1. Open “Contacts” and go to “All contacts”
  2. Select the contact you want to remove
  3. Tap “Edit” > “Menu” > “Delete”
  4. Press “OK” to confirm

Create a Caller Group Using a Contact:

  1. Open “Contacts”
  2. Access “All contacts”
  3. Select the contact you want to use for creating the caller group
  4. Tap “More Fields” > “Group name” > “Create new group”
  5. Enter the desired group name and tap “OK” to confirm

Assign Contacts to an Existing Caller Group:

  1. Launch “Contacts”
  2. Access “All contacts”
  3. Select the contact you want to link with the caller group
  4. Tap “Edit” > “More Fields”
  5. Tap “Group name” and select the desired caller group
  6. Press “OK” to confirm
